Question : If a 7-storey building has a 28 m long shadow, the number of storeys of the building whose shadow is 48 m long is:
Option 1: 14
Option 2: 24
Option 3: 16
Option 4: 12

Correct Answer: 12
Solution : Length of shadow of a 7-storey building = 28 m Let the number of stories of the building with a 48 m long shadow be $x$. During the same time of the day, the sun shall cast proportional shadows on all the objects, Hence, $\frac{7}{28}=\frac{x}{48}$ ⇒ $x=\frac{48}{4}$ ⇒ $x=12$. Hence, the correct answer is 12.
